Conversion formula
The conversion factor from liters to cubic inches is 61.023743836666, which means that 1 liter is equal to 61.023743836666 cubic inches:
1 L = 61.023743836666 in3
To convert 113.1 liters into cubic inches we have to multiply 113.1 by the conversion factor in order to get the volume amount from liters to cubic inches. We can also form a simple proportion to calculate the result:
1 L → 61.023743836666 in3
113.1 L → V(in3)
Solve the above proportion to obtain the volume V in cubic inches:
V(in3) = 113.1 L × 61.023743836666 in3
V(in3) = 6901.7854279269 in3
The final result is:
113.1 L → 6901.7854279269 in3
We conclude that 113.1 liters is equivalent to 6901.7854279269 cubic inches:
113.1 liters = 6901.7854279269 cubic inches
